Why you should be Meal Prepping

Meal Prepping is a great time-saving way to eat healthy during the week. The concept of meal prepping is to plan, shop, and cook your food for the week in a day. There are several benefits to meal prepping. First, it will save you tons of money. When meal prepping you can eliminate the option of eating out and making 3 or more unnecessary trips to grocery store.

The first step of Meal prepping is planning. Plan your meals and recipes ahead of time, so you know exactly what to get from the grocery store. You will likely buy everything you need and avoid spending too much money in the store. Another benefit of meal prepping is that it saves a lot of time. This can be even more beneficial to those who have work or school. It’s an easy grab-and-go process.

After you cook your food, separate them into reasonable portions and place them in separate containers for certain days of the week. Then, when lunch or dinner time comes, pop the container in the microwave, and you’re ready to eat. A tip for this would to buy a generous amount of Tupperware to make it easy for you. Containers can be fairly inexpensive online on a website like Amazon.  

Meal prepping also allows someone who is busy and has limited time, to remain healthy. It’s important to have veggies, protein, and whole grains to get as much nutrition as possible out of each meal. It also allows you to control your portion sizes. When you distribute your food in containers you can limit your chances of overeating.

Meal prepping is a great dynamic to add to your fitness routine. It will allow you to eat healthy, save money, and remain time conscious while juggling a busy work or school schedule.
